What other barriers are there? State laws? I mean, if a state votes to have laws that create barriers, that's their choice. It's actually not that easy for states to legislate about interstate commerce without getting superseded by federal law under the supremacy clause and commerce clause, by the way.


State laws are regulations. There are non-regulatory barriers. Such as cost and networking. Is it really worth it to set up a network with doctors and hospitals in an area where you aren't going to have many customers? I mean some states already allow sales between state lines, and we've not seen the expected result of lowering premiums or expanding access.
